About the Program

Biological Sciences is a bachelor's degree program taught in English at the University of Szczecin in Szczecin, Poland, lasting 6 semesters, or 3 years. The program is designed for people interested in water biology who want to build on their interest in the animate world of the hydrosphere. Coursework draws on biology, ecology, molecular biology, chemistry, and geography to give students a grounding in water biology specifically. Through laboratory classes, fieldwork, and lectures, students learn about the living and non-living components of water bodies, connecting this knowledge to the types of water bodies involved and the areas where they occur. By the end of the program, graduates are able to interpret and describe natural phenomena that occur within aquatic ecosystems. Students have access to research equipment belonging to the university's Centre for Molecular Biology and Biotechnology and its Mobile Center for Ecological Education and Environmental Monitoring. Biological sciences as a discipline covers the study of living organisms at every scale, from molecules and cells up to whole ecosystems, and a concentration in water biology narrows that scope to rivers, lakes, wetlands, and coastal and marine environments. Students typically study topics such as microbiology, genetics, physiology, and environmental monitoring techniques alongside the specialized hydrobiology content, building skills in laboratory analysis, fieldwork, and data interpretation. Graduates of biology programs with this kind of environmental and aquatic focus go on to work in environmental monitoring agencies, water management authorities, conservation organizations, research institutes, and consultancies that assess water quality and ecosystem health. Others continue into master's-level study in biological or environmental sciences, or move into teaching and science communication roles connected to ecology and environmental protection.
